The Basics of Positive Thinking

At its core, positive thinking is the practice of focusing on the positive aspects of life and having an optimistic outlook. It involves training your mind to see the good in every situation, even when faced with challenges and difficulties. It is not about ignoring or denying the negative, but rather choosing to see the silver lining and finding ways to overcome obstacles.

The Benefits of Positive Thinking

The power of positive thinking lies in its ability to shape our mindset and perception of the world. By choosing to focus on the positive, we can improve our overall well-being and quality of life. Here are some of the benefits of practicing positive thinking:

1. Improved Mental Health

Positive thinking can have a profound impact on our mental health. By focusing on the good, we can reduce stress, anxiety, and depression. It can also help us cope with difficult emotions and improve our overall mood.

2. Increased Resilience

Positive thinking can help us develop resilience, which is the ability to bounce back from challenges and setbacks. By training our minds to see the good in every situation, we can better cope with adversity and come out stronger on the other side.

3. Better Relationships

Our mindset and outlook can also affect our relationships with others. By being more positive, we can attract like-minded people and foster healthier and more fulfilling relationships. It can also help us resolve conflicts and communicate effectively.

How to Cultivate Positive Thinking

Positive thinking is a skill that can be learned and practiced. Here are some tips on how to cultivate a more positive mindset:

1. Practice Gratitude

Taking time each day to appreciate and be thankful for the good things in our lives can help shift our focus towards the positive.

2. Surround Yourself with Positivity

The people we surround ourselves with and the content we consume can greatly influence our mindset. Surround yourself with positive and uplifting people and media.

3. Challenge Negative Thoughts

When negative thoughts creep in, challenge them and try to find a more positive perspective. Remember that thoughts are not facts, and we have the power to change them.
